Utopia can be seen as a state in which utopia allows a space for wishes, dreams and a desire for something better. In my degree project I have chosen to explore the historical utopian ideas to create a content that treats utopia on a subjective level. With visual communication as a starting point I have tried to fixate this state in a book.
